Az Zawr
City in Al Asimah, Kuwait
Overview
Az Zawr is a coastal industrial enclave in the Al Asimah region of Kuwait, located near vital shipping ports and oil facilities. While primarily industrial, the area's proximity to the sea brings scenic views and access to traditional fishing spots, offering a unique gateway into Kuwait's maritime life.
